Is Cottage Cheese A Healthy Fat

Cottage cheese is a beloved food among health enthusiasts and fitness buffs, and for good reason. It is an excellent source of protein and healthy fats, making it a great addition to a balanced diet. The key purpose of cottage cheese is to provide a feeling of fullness and satisfaction, while also supporting muscle growth and repair.

One of the main benefits of cottage cheese is its high protein content, which can help to build and repair muscles. This makes it a popular choice among athletes and bodybuilders. Additionally, cottage cheese is rich in calcium, which is essential for maintaining strong bones and teeth. For example, a person who engages in regular physical activity may find that consuming cottage cheese after a workout helps to reduce muscle soreness and support recovery.

In everyday life, cottage cheese can be incorporated into a variety of dishes, such as salads, smoothies, and oatmeal. It can also be eaten on its own as a quick and easy snack. To get the most out of cottage cheese, it's a good idea to choose a low-sodium version and pair it with other nutrient-dense foods, such as fruits and vegetables.
